Transaction ab4983d0e4110534edbb018aef5c09ca36bfbdddb315be601bfa7377503ee441

4 Input
1 Outputs
  • ab4983d0e4110534edbb018aef5c09ca36bfbdddb315be601bfa7377503ee441:0
  • value  15992391
    address  3B89n73LkJNjgcrfpZ5cwCWugNHbPXbbSh